King v. State

Supreme Court of Florida
May 4, 2004
874 So. 2d 1192 (Fla. 2004)

Opinion

Case No. SC03-2385.

May 4, 2004.

Lower Tribunal No. 4D03-3585.


Having received responses from the State of Florida and the Fourth District Court of Appeal to this Court's order dated March 9, 2004, and having considered Petitioner's Motion to Voluntarily Dismiss, incorporated in his reply to the responses, as a proper notice of dismissal pursuant to Florida Rule of Appellate Procedure 9.350(b), it is ordered that the Petition for Writs of Mandamus and Prohibition be and the same is hereby voluntarily dismissed.

Petitioner's Emergency Motion for Stay of District Court Proceedings is hereby denied as moot in light of this disposition.
